Как сделать резервную копию локальной базы данных SQL Server в XP? - PullRequest
2 голосов
/ 20 марта 2011

На моем ПК разработан веб-сайт ASP.NET 3.5

Чтобы развернуть базу данных на используемом мной хосте, они требуют, чтобы я «восстановил» ее, используя резервную копию базы данных.

Как мне создать резервную копию базы данных на моем компьютере под управлением XP?

Есть ли способ сделать это в Visual Web Developer? Я также скачал диспетчер конфигурации SQL Server, но не вижу возможности для резервного копирования.

Любая помощь приветствуется!

(Visual Web Developer Express с SQL Server Express 2005)

Спасибо.

EDIT
Мое решение благодаря ответам ниже:
Прямо в SQL-панели Visual Web Developer Express я выполнил оператор -

BACKUP DATABASE [C:\Mysite\App_Data\ASPNETDB.MDF] TO DISK = N'C:\Backup.bak' WITH NOFORMAT, NOINIT, NAME = N'YourDB-Full Database Backup', 
SKIP, NOREWIND, NOUNLOAD, STATS = 10;

Это создало резервную копию с некоторыми предупреждениями, не совсем уверенными в том, что они имели в виду, поскольку в нем упоминались «пропущенные столбцы», с которыми я не знаком. После загрузки базы данных на хост это выглядело так, как будто все было, я скоро смогу проверить ее и обновлю, если я что-то сделал неправильно или пропустил.

Ответы [ 2 ]

4 голосов
/ 20 марта 2011

Вы должны быть в состоянии сделать это через графический интерфейс в Management Studio или настроить следующий скрипт и запустить:служебная учетная запись имеет права на запись (папка Backup в каталоге MSSQL - хорошая ставка).

2 голосов
/ 20 марта 2011

Получить SQL Server Management Studio 2008 R2 (выберите только Средства управления), если у вас его нет.Это поможет вам управлять вашей базой данных.Пользовательский интерфейс прост в управлении - разверните дерево слева до необходимой базы данных и щелкните правой кнопкой мыши -> Резервная копия базы данных

...